161 Commits (920e1e94fab9d1a39f8e5412bf4677bf9b63ef50)

Author SHA1 Message Date
SomberNight bf7129d57e
synchronizer/verifier: ensure fairness between wallets (follow-up) 5 years ago
SomberNight 24d47022b4
util: assert that Decimal precision is sufficient 5 years ago
SomberNight 7294613447
util.is_hex_str: forbid whitespaces 5 years ago
SomberNight 1abecf25c9
qt block explorer: allow custom URL 5 years ago
SomberNight d40bedb2ac
also support uppercase bip21 URIs 5 years ago
SomberNight 8c5601a172
dnspython: fix deprecation warnings when using dnspython 2.0 5 years ago
SomberNight dbb7d7ce4d
network: set _loop_thread again as it helps debugging 5 years ago
Stephan Oeste a5acb7d695
add mempool.emzy.de 5 years ago
SomberNight 57768244bb
qt history list: fix #6746 5 years ago
SomberNight 120da2783b
util.randrange: use stdlib 'secrets' module instead of 'python-ecdsa' 5 years ago
SomberNight c5da22a9dd
network: tighten checks of server responses for type/sanity 5 years ago
bitromortac 193b17f0e4
util: move json_normalize to util 5 years ago
SomberNight ea3e3ddbb8
lnpeer: handle cooperative close edge-case 5 years ago
SomberNight 5d723401f8
util.NetworkRetryManager: fix potential overflow 5 years ago
SomberNight 36178df875
sql: test read-write permissions for given path and raise early 5 years ago
Tigerix 8539beb75e
Update util.py 6 years ago
SomberNight d19ff43266
interface: check server response for some methods 6 years ago
richard b1a70be079
Add mempool.space option for mainnet block explorer (#6261) 6 years ago
SomberNight 662d0d92bd
remote watchtower: enforce that SSL is used, on the client-side 6 years ago
SomberNight d5f368c584
LN invoices: support msat precision 6 years ago
ThomasV 4bda882695 Group swap transactions in Qt history (fixes #6237) 6 years ago
SomberNight b6db201570
util: small clean-up for format_satoshis 6 years ago
SomberNight 2c962abe51
network: randomise the order of address subscriptions 6 years ago
SomberNight a32cb7784f
myAiohttpClient: add id counter, and rename to JsonRPCClient 6 years ago
ThomasV 30f5be26ac Remove dependencies: jsonrpcserver, jsonrpcclient 6 years ago
ThomasV 56f4932f10 import/exports to json files: 6 years ago
ThomasV 6058829870 Use attr.s classes for invoices and requests: 6 years ago
SomberNight 54fdb011f9
fixups for CallbackManager refactor 6 years ago
SomberNight 223b62554e
lntransport: use network proxy if available 6 years ago
SomberNight 7257172e1c
NetworkRetryManager: add random noise to time 6 years ago
SomberNight 76f0ad3271
util: add NetworkRetryManager, a baseclass for LNWorker and Network 6 years ago
ThomasV 9224404108 Move callback manager out of Network class 6 years ago
SomberNight fe86f91110
adapt to new aiohttp_socks: fix deprecation warnings 6 years ago
SomberNight ea0981ebeb
lnutil.UpdateAddHtlc: use attrs instead of old-style namedtuple 6 years ago
ThomasV 3d69f3b0be improve payment status callbacks: 6 years ago
SomberNight 7962e17df6
invoices: deal with expiration of "0" mess 6 years ago
SomberNight 2fab681444
bolt11 invoice: strip (and so accept with) leading/trailing whitespaces 6 years ago
SomberNight ed234d3444
rename all TaskGroup() fields to "taskgroup" 6 years ago
Jakub Łukasiewicz c121230706
Added ELECTRUMDIR env variable (#5543) 6 years ago
SomberNight 0723355a0f
util.Satoshis: note that sometimes this actually has 'msat' precision 6 years ago
ThomasV e3ccfe6449 kivy: make backups optional 6 years ago
SomberNight 497d6019e1 kivy/android: ask for STORAGE permission at runtime 6 years ago
ThomasV 2dad87cbb4 Automate backups: 6 years ago
ThomasV 87b7d2c0c0 wallet backup function for kivy/android 6 years ago
SomberNight 004acb906d
ecc: abstract away some usage of python-ecdsa: randrange 6 years ago
ThomasV dbceed2647 Restructure wallet storage: 6 years ago
SomberNight 6d270364c6
qt paytoedit: properly handle multiple max ('!') outputs 6 years ago
rbrooklyn 3658f87035 Add block explorer support for mynode.local (#5892) 6 years ago
SomberNight 2d57a689d9
network/util: increase default timeout of make_aiohttp_session (30->45s) 6 years ago
SomberNight 2ca535225d
util.standardize_path: properly handle "~" (user's home directory) 6 years ago